Operation Phuket

The flight was only a short journey, nearly a hour I think properly the same from the UK to Amsterdam but that's another story.

As soon as I got off the plane it was hoter than Bangkok and that was hot. There wasn't a cloud in the sky and you could see the hills and jungle and it looked like something off a post card, amazing. I collected my bag and from that moment I realised I did not have a clue were to go. Phuket was my oyster as they say, so walking through the airport to the transfer desk and after having a chat to the rep decided on travelling to Patong.

Outside trying find my bus was a mission and a half and there must of been 20 or 30 mini vans parked up, and bags were being carried and loads of people out side, the drivers seemed like they knew what they were doing but by the look on everyone elses faces no one else did and I found that quite amusing. Next minuet a Thai driver grabbed my bag and said come with me so I followed passing all the new mini buses with air con and leather seats all that I was hoping for all the way across the car park to the worst vehicle i have ever seen, rust, no paint, it was like a scene from a film, I couldn't help wonder if we were actually going make it to our destination.

The journey was nice passing all the jungle covered hills and the small villages on the way, it was exactly the kind of Thailand I was watching on the travel program and I felt so good and exited as this was exactly what I was looking for. In the mini bus I devised a small plan as I didn't have a clue what to do. I just thought if I see some were nice then I would jump out and find a hotel around that area. As we drove on the out skirts of Patong I noticed a build up of houses and loads of advertisement bill boards so I knew I was close. We went passed the shooting range and the go kart track so I knew as soon as I could see the beach I would jump out. As soon as a saw the beech it was hypnotising, it was a beautiful big sandy beach and clear turquoise sea total paradise.
